1. Buoyant Material
The selection of buoyant material is paramount to the functionality and safety of pool floats designed to resemble pizza slices. The inherent ability of these materials to remain afloat under load determines the float’s usability and the user’s experience.
-
Density and Displacement
The chosen material must possess a density lower than that of water, allowing it to displace a volume of water equivalent to its weight and any additional load it is intended to support. For instance, closed-cell polyethylene foam is frequently utilized due to its low density and capacity to displace a significant volume relative to its mass.
-
Material Durability and Resistance
Pool floats are subject to constant exposure to chlorinated water, UV radiation, and physical stress. Therefore, the buoyant material must exhibit resistance to degradation caused by these factors. PVC, for example, is often treated with UV inhibitors to prolong its lifespan and prevent premature cracking or fading.
-
Structural Integrity and Load Capacity
The material’s structural integrity dictates its ability to maintain its shape and support weight without deformation. Thicker gauges of PVC or higher density foam are employed to enhance load-bearing capacity, allowing the float to accommodate users of varying sizes and weights. Reinforced seams and internal supports may further augment structural stability.
-
Environmental Impact and Sustainability
Increasingly, manufacturers are considering the environmental footprint of their products. Alternative buoyant materials, such as recycled plastics or bio-based foams, are emerging as potentially more sustainable options compared to traditional petroleum-based plastics. However, these alternatives must still meet the required performance standards for buoyancy, durability, and safety.
The properties of the buoyant material directly influence the overall performance, longevity, and environmental impact of pool floats shaped like pizza slices. Ongoing research and development efforts are focused on identifying and implementing materials that offer a balanced combination of buoyancy, durability, sustainability, and cost-effectiveness.
2. Modular Design
The modular design of pool floats resembling pizza slices represents a significant enhancement in the user experience and functionality. This design principle, characterized by independent, interconnectable units, directly contributes to the adaptability and social appeal of these recreational items. The segmentation into individual “slices” allows for a flexible arrangement, enabling users to configure the floats according to their preferences and the size of their group. The inherent cause and effect relationship lies in the modularity causing enhanced user interaction and customization. A single slice offers individual relaxation, while multiple slices combined form a larger communal floating platform. The ability to physically connect separate floats encourages social interaction within a pool environment.
Examples of the practical significance of this modular design are evident in its application at pool parties and social gatherings. Participants can each bring a slice and collectively assemble a complete “pizza,” fostering a sense of shared activity and camaraderie. Commercially available options often include connector mechanisms, such as perimeter loops or interlocking clips, facilitating secure attachment. The design also allows for ease of storage and transportation, as individual slices can be stacked or nested, minimizing the space required compared to a single, large, non-modular float. Furthermore, if one section sustains damage, it can be replaced without rendering the entire float unusable.

Frequently Asked Questions
This section addresses common inquiries regarding the construction, usage, and maintenance of pool floats designed to resemble pizza slices, aiming to provide clear and concise information for potential consumers.
Question 1: What materials are typically used in the construction of a pool float pizza?
Pool float pizzas are commonly manufactured from durable polyvinyl chloride (PVC) or closed-cell foam. These materials are selected for their buoyancy, resistance to water damage, and ability to withstand prolonged exposure to sunlight and chlorine.
Question 2: What is the recommended weight capacity for a single slice of pool float pizza?
The weight capacity varies depending on the size and construction of the float. Most single slices are designed to support between 150 and 250 pounds. Exceeding the recommended weight limit may compromise the float’s structural integrity and buoyancy.
Question 3: How should a pool float pizza be properly inflated and deflated?
Inflation typically requires an air pump. Ensure the valve is securely closed after inflation to prevent air leakage. Deflation can be achieved by opening the valve and gently pressing on the float to expel air. Avoid using sharp objects that could puncture the material.
Question 4: What are the recommended cleaning and storage procedures for a pool float pizza?
After each use, rinse the float with fresh water to remove chlorine and debris. Allow the float to dry completely before storing it in a cool, dry place away from direct sunlight. Proper storage can extend the float’s lifespan and prevent mildew growth.
Question 5: Are pool float pizzas safe for children?
While providing buoyancy, pool float pizzas are not life-saving devices. Children should always be supervised by a competent adult when using any pool float. Adherence to safety guidelines and responsible usage are essential to prevent accidents.
Question 6: Can multiple slices of pool float pizza be connected together?
Many pool float pizzas are designed with connecting mechanisms, such as perimeter loops or interlocking clips, allowing multiple slices to be joined together to form a larger floating platform. This feature promotes social interaction and shared recreational experiences.

Pool Float Pizza
This section provides crucial guidelines for maximizing the enjoyment and longevity of pizza-shaped pool floats, ensuring both safety and product preservation.
Tip 1: Inspect Before Inflation. Prior to inflating, thoroughly examine the float for any signs of punctures, tears, or weakened seams. Address minor damages with appropriate repair kits before use to prevent further degradation during inflation.
Tip 2: Avoid Over-Inflation. Adhere strictly to the manufacturer’s inflation guidelines. Over-inflating the float can stress the material, leading to seam failure, reduced buoyancy, and a shortened lifespan. A slightly under-inflated float is preferable to an over-inflated one.
Tip 3: Rinse After Each Use. Chlorinated or saltwater can degrade the material over time. Rinse the float with fresh water after each use to remove chemical residues and prolong its lifespan.
Tip 4: Protect from Direct Sunlight. Prolonged exposure to ultraviolet radiation can cause fading, cracking, and a loss of elasticity. Store the float in a shaded area or indoors when not in use to minimize UV damage.
Tip 5: Store Properly. Ensure the float is completely dry before storing it. Fold or roll it loosely to prevent creases and store it in a cool, dry place. Avoid stacking heavy objects on top of the deflated float, as this can cause permanent deformation.
Tip 6: Use Caution Near Sharp Objects. Exercise caution when using the float near sharp objects, such as pool edges, rocks, or other pool accessories. Punctures can compromise the float’s buoyancy and necessitate repairs.
Tip 7: Supervise Children Closely. While visually appealing and entertaining, pool floats are not life-saving devices. Children should be constantly supervised by a responsible adult when using any pool float, including those shaped like pizza slices.
Adhering to these guidelines will extend the lifespan of the pool float pizza, ensuring continued enjoyment and preventing costly replacements.
